The case is suitable for strategy and general management courses because it raises questions about a company's basic direction and business definition, and the management of complex issues associated with doing business worldwide. Because this case suggests the overlap of key marketing decisions with strategic questions, it can also be used in both required and elective marketing courses, especially for topics on distribution of consumer products and brand management. This case can be used in advanced undergraduate, MBA, or executive-level courses.
